Moodle APIs 3.9
Moodle 3.9.13+ (Build: 20220325)
core_enrol_external Member List

This is the complete list of members for core_enrol_external, including all inherited members.

call_external_function($function, $args, $ajaxonly=false)external_apistatic
clean_returnvalue(external_description $description, $response)external_apistatic
edit_user_enrolment($courseid, $ueid, $status, $timestart=0, $timeend=0)core_enrol_externalstatic
edit_user_enrolment_is_deprecated()core_enrol_externalstatic
edit_user_enrolment_parameters()core_enrol_externalstatic
edit_user_enrolment_returns()core_enrol_externalstatic
external_function_info($function, $strictness=MUST_EXIST)external_apistatic
get_context_from_params($param)external_apiprotectedstatic
get_context_parameters()external_apiprotectedstatic
get_course_enrolment_methods($courseid)core_enrol_externalstatic
get_course_enrolment_methods_parameters()core_enrol_externalstatic
get_course_enrolment_methods_returns()core_enrol_externalstatic
get_enrolled_users($courseid, $options=array())core_enrol_externalstatic
get_enrolled_users_parameters()core_enrol_externalstatic
get_enrolled_users_returns()core_enrol_externalstatic
get_enrolled_users_with_capability($coursecapabilities, $options)core_enrol_externalstatic
get_enrolled_users_with_capability_parameters()core_enrol_externalstatic
get_enrolled_users_with_capability_returns()core_enrol_externalstatic
get_potential_users($courseid, $enrolid, $search, $searchanywhere, $page, $perpage)core_enrol_externalstatic
get_potential_users_parameters()core_enrol_externalstatic
get_potential_users_returns()core_enrol_externalstatic
get_users_courses($userid, $returnusercount=true)core_enrol_externalstatic
get_users_courses_parameters()core_enrol_externalstatic
get_users_courses_returns()core_enrol_externalstatic
search_users(int $courseid, string $search, bool $searchanywhere, int $page, int $perpage)core_enrol_externalstatic
search_users_parameters()core_enrol_externalstatic
search_users_returns()core_enrol_externalstatic
set_context_restriction($context)external_apistatic
set_timeout($seconds=360)external_apistatic
submit_user_enrolment_form($formdata)core_enrol_externalstatic
submit_user_enrolment_form_parameters()core_enrol_externalstatic
submit_user_enrolment_form_returns()core_enrol_externalstatic
unenrol_user_enrolment($ueid)core_enrol_externalstatic
unenrol_user_enrolment_parameters()core_enrol_externalstatic
unenrol_user_enrolment_returns()core_enrol_externalstatic
validate_context($context)external_apistatic
validate_parameters(external_description $description, $params)external_apistatic